List of all items
Structs
- accounts::impersonated_account::ImpersonatedAccount
- accounts::predicate::Predicate
- accounts::provider::Provider
- accounts::provider::ResourceFilter
- accounts::provider::RetryConfig
- accounts::provider::TransactionCost
- accounts::wallet::Wallet
- accounts::wallet::WalletUnlocked
- client::FuelClient
- client::PaginationRequest
- core::Configurables
- core::codec::ABIDecoder
- core::codec::ABIEncoder
- core::codec::DecoderConfig
- core::codec::EncoderConfig
- core::codec::LogDecoder
- core::codec::LogFormatter
- core::codec::LogId
- core::codec::LogResult
- crypto::Hasher
- crypto::Message
- crypto::PublicKey
- crypto::SecretKey
- crypto::Signature
- programs::calls::CallHandler
- programs::calls::CallParameters
- programs::calls::ContractCall
- programs::calls::ScriptCall
- programs::calls::receipt_parser::ReceiptParser
- programs::contract::BlobsNotUploaded
- programs::contract::BlobsUploaded
- programs::contract::Contract
- programs::contract::LoadConfiguration
- programs::contract::Loader
- programs::contract::Regular
- programs::contract::StorageConfiguration
- programs::executable::Executable
- programs::executable::Loader
- programs::executable::Regular
- programs::responses::CallResponse
- programs::responses::SubmitResponse
- test_helpers::AssetConfig
- test_helpers::ChainConfig
- test_helpers::FuelService
- test_helpers::NodeConfig
- test_helpers::StateConfig
- test_helpers::WalletsConfig
- tx::GasCosts
- tx::StorageSlot
- tx::TxPointer
- tx::UploadSubsection
- tx::UtxoId
- tx::Witness
- tx::field::StorageSlotRef
- types::Address
- types::AsciiString
- types::AssetId
- types::B512
- types::Bits256
- types::BlockHeight
- types::Bytes
- types::Bytes32
- types::Bytes4
- types::Bytes64
- types::Bytes8
- types::ChainId
- types::ContractId
- types::DryRun
- types::EvmAddress
- types::MessageId
- types::Nonce
- types::RawSlice
- types::Salt
- types::SizedAsciiString
- types::StaticStringToken
- types::U256
- types::bech32::Bech32Address
- types::bech32::Bech32ContractId
- types::block::Block
- types::block::Header
- types::chain_info::ChainInfo
- types::coin::Coin
- types::gas_price::EstimateGasPrice
- types::gas_price::LatestGasPrice
- types::message::Message
- types::message_proof::MerkleProof
- types::message_proof::MessageProof
- types::node_info::NodeInfo
- types::param_types::EnumVariants
- types::transaction::BlobTransaction
- types::transaction::CreateTransaction
- types::transaction::MintTransaction
- types::transaction::ScriptTransaction
- types::transaction::Transactions
- types::transaction::TxPolicies
- types::transaction::UpgradeTransaction
- types::transaction::UploadTransaction
- types::transaction_builders::Blob
- types::transaction_builders::BlobTransactionBuilder
- types::transaction_builders::CreateTransactionBuilder
- types::transaction_builders::ScriptTransactionBuilder
- types::transaction_builders::UpgradeTransactionBuilder
- types::transaction_builders::UploadSubsection
- types::transaction_builders::UploadTransactionBuilder
- types::transaction_response::TransactionResponse
Enums
- accounts::provider::Backoff
- client::PageDirection
- programs::calls::Execution
- test_helpers::DbType
- test_helpers::Trigger
- tx::ConsensusParameters
- tx::ContractParameters
- tx::FeeParameters
- tx::FuelTransaction
- tx::PredicateParameters
- tx::Receipt
- tx::ScriptExecutionResult
- tx::ScriptParameters
- tx::TxParameters
- tx::UpgradePurpose
- types::Identity
- types::Token
- types::coin::CoinStatus
- types::coin_type::CoinType
- types::coin_type_id::CoinTypeId
- types::errors::Error
- types::errors::transaction::Reason
- types::input::Input
- types::message::MessageStatus
- types::output::Output
- types::param_types::ParamType
- types::param_types::ReturnLocation
- types::transaction::TransactionType
- types::transaction_builders::ScriptBuildStrategy
- types::transaction_builders::Strategy
- types::transaction_builders::UpgradePurpose
- types::transaction_builders::VariableOutputPolicy
- types::tx_status::TxStatus
Traits
- accounts::Account
- accounts::ViewOnlyAccount
- core::traits::Parameterize
- core::traits::Signer
- core::traits::Tokenizable
- programs::calls::ContractDependency
- programs::calls::traits::ContractDependencyConfigurator
- programs::calls::traits::ResponseParser
- programs::calls::traits::TransactionTuner
- tx::ContractIdExt
- tx::field::BlobId
- tx::field::BytecodeRoot
- tx::field::BytecodeWitnessIndex
- tx::field::ChargeableBody
- tx::field::InputContract
- tx::field::Inputs
- tx::field::Maturity
- tx::field::MaxFeeLimit
- tx::field::MintAmount
- tx::field::MintAssetId
- tx::field::MintGasPrice
- tx::field::OutputContract
- tx::field::Outputs
- tx::field::Policies
- tx::field::ProofSet
- tx::field::ReceiptsRoot
- tx::field::Salt
- tx::field::Script
- tx::field::ScriptData
- tx::field::ScriptGasLimit
- tx::field::StorageSlots
- tx::field::SubsectionIndex
- tx::field::SubsectionsNumber
- tx::field::Tip
- tx::field::TxPointer
- tx::field::UpgradePurpose
- tx::field::WitnessLimit
- tx::field::Witnesses
- types::DryRunner
- types::transaction::EstimablePredicates
- types::transaction::GasValidation
- types::transaction::Transaction
- types::transaction::ValidatablePredicates
- types::transaction_builders::BuildableTransaction
- types::transaction_builders::TransactionBuilder
Macros
- core::codec::calldata
- macros::abigen
- macros::setup_program_test
- macros::wasm_abigen
- types::errors::error
- types::errors::error_transaction
Derive Macros
Functions
- accounts::wallet::generate_mnemonic_phrase
- core::codec::encode_fn_selector
- core::codec::log_formatters_lookup
- core::codec::try_from_bytes
- core::offsets::base_offset_script
- core::offsets::call_script_data_offset
- programs::calls::utils::find_id_of_missing_contract
- programs::calls::utils::is_missing_output_variables
- programs::contract::loader_contract_asm
- test_helpers::generate_random_salt
- test_helpers::launch_custom_provider_and_get_wallets
- test_helpers::launch_provider_and_get_wallet
- test_helpers::setup_custom_assets_coins
- test_helpers::setup_multiple_assets_coins
- test_helpers::setup_single_asset_coins
- test_helpers::setup_single_message
- test_helpers::setup_test_provider
- types::checksum_address::checksum_encode
- types::checksum_address::is_checksum_valid
- types::pad_string
- types::pad_u16
- types::pad_u32
- types::transaction::extract_owner_or_recipient
- types::transaction_builders::create_coin_input
- types::transaction_builders::create_coin_message_input
- types::transaction_builders::create_coin_message_predicate
- types::transaction_builders::create_coin_predicate
Type Aliases
- tx::TxId
- types::ByteArray
- types::EnumSelector
- types::Selector
- types::Word
- types::errors::Result
- types::param_types::NamedParamType
- types::transaction_builders::BlobId
Constants
- accounts::provider::SUPPORTED_FUEL_CORE_VERSION
- accounts::wallet::DEFAULT_DERIVATION_PATH_PREFIX
- core::constants::DEFAULT_CALL_PARAMS_AMOUNT
- core::constants::DEFAULT_GAS_ESTIMATION_BLOCK_HORIZON
- core::constants::DEFAULT_GAS_ESTIMATION_TOLERANCE
- core::constants::ENUM_DISCRIMINANT_BYTE_WIDTH
- core::constants::SIGNATURE_WITNESS_SIZE
- core::constants::WITNESS_STATIC_SIZE
- core::constants::WORD_SIZE
- test_helpers::DEFAULT_COIN_AMOUNT
- test_helpers::DEFAULT_NUM_COINS
- test_helpers::DEFAULT_NUM_WALLETS
- types::bech32::FUEL_BECH32_HRP